Ammon Hontz, the owner and operator of A.D. Home Inspections was born and raised in the small, old town of Jim Thorpe, PA. Throughout his life, he has worked in many aspects of both construction and remodeling on both old and new structures. Along with that, he has LIVED in both old, and custom built homes, and has a unique knowledge about both types of dwellings. Many think that newer is better, while others like a home that has “character”. Well, newer is not always better, and character at times, can bring expenses and problems that would be unforeseen by the untrained, inexperienced eye. On the opposite end of that spectrum, newer CAN be better IF it is done properly. Just as character CAN add to the home owning experience, IF you are not expecting the 100 year old house to have all the modern code standards that today’s unified building code demands.
